An arrest warrant has been issued for Dr. Jill Stein, a 2024 presidential candidate, after she and her attorney failed to appear in court for an assault charge stemming from an April 2024 protest. St. Louis Judge Karma Johnson issued the order on Monday
morning. Dr. Stein, who ran as the Green Party presidential candidate, faces one count of first-degree trespassing and one count of fourth-degree assault. These charges originate from an incident on April 27, 2024, at Washington University's Danforth campus. During the protest, which began in Forest Park and moved onto the campus, demonstrators chanted phrases related to the Israeli-Palestinian conflict and entered the Olin Library, leading to its evacuation. Court documents allege that during an attempt by officers to clear the area, Dr. Stein grabbed an officer's bicycle, which then struck another officer. She is further accused of kicking Officer Moore multiple times in the right leg near the groin, resulting in a strain in his left forearm, a contusion, and a groin injury.

The St. Louis County Prosecuting Attorney Melissa Price Smith previously clarified that the charges are not a statement on freedom of speech or assembly, but rather reflect sufficient evidence for the specific criminal charges.
